Mazhar-Ul-Haq is a compound of "mazhar" (manifestation, from the root z-h-r) and "al-Haq" (the Truth), meaning "manifestation of Truth."

Reference Profile

Etymology

A compound of mazhar ('manifestation') and al-haqq ('the Truth,' one of the names of Allah). Mazhar-ul-Haq means 'manifestation of the Truth.'

Islamic Significance

Built on al-Haqq, the Truth, one of the names of Allah; compounds of this pattern parallel the X al-Din titles.

Quranic Connection

Quran 22:6: that is because Allah is the Truth, and because He gives life to the dead.

Cultural / Regional Usage

Used across South Asian Muslim communities.
